For the 2025-26 school year, there are 2 public elementary schools serving 227 students in Egyptian CUSD 5 School District. This district's average elementary testing ranking is 1/10, which is in the bottom 50% of public elementary schools in Illinois.
Public Elementary Schools in Egyptian CUSD 5 School District have an average math proficiency score of 9% (versus the Illinois public elementary school average of 27%), and reading proficiency score of 10% (versus the 30%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 24% of the student body (majority Black), which is less than the Illinois public elementary school average of 55% (majority Hispanic).

Egyptian CUSD 5 School District, which is ranked within the bottom 50% of all 864 school districts in Illinois (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data) for the 2022-2023 school year.
The school district's graduation rate of 85% has increased from 60-79% over five school years.

District Revenue and Spending

The revenue/student of $23,337 is higher than the state median of $22,423. The school district revenue/student has grown by 21% over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$21,908 is higher than the state median of $21,662. The school district spending/student has grown by 21% over four school years.
